Richard Koch is an investor and author. He rescued Filofax and was founder of The LEK Partnership, the most successful international business strategy "boutique" of the early 1990s, taking a major share stake whose value multiplied many times. He has also financed Belgo, the highly acclaimed theme restaurant concept and MSI, the hotel chain. He is non-executive director of several quoted and unquoted companies, including Advent Venture Capital Trust Plc.
